1941(13 Sept.) A 'Prize Court Cover' from Shanghai registered to Denmark, bearing SYS New York print 50c in pair, tied by bilingual 'SHANGHAI', on reverse, hand stamped 'Released by Prize Cort' in 2 straight black. During WWII mails with restricted materials such as coins and stamps etc., To Axis countries were held in Bermuda until after the war and sold by the Bermuda Prize Court in various auctions between 1948 and 1950. fine.
